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Axehead Orange | holy-flax |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(động vật) | Plantae (thực vật)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(động vật Chân khớp)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Insecta (côn trùng)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(bộ Cánh vảy) | Asterales (Bộ Cúc) |
| Family | Hesperiidae | Asteraceae (Daisy Family) |
| Genus | Acada | Santolina |
| Species | Acada biseriatus | Santolina rosmarinifolia |
